CVE-2026-34352
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edIn TigerVNC before 1.16.2, Image.cxx in x0vncserver allows other users to observe or manipulate the screen contents, or cause an application crash, because of incorrect permissions.

dbcve analysis · moderate confidenceTigerVNC before version 1.16.2 contains a permission vulnerability in Image.cxx within the x0vncserver component. The incorrect permissions on shared memory or framebuffer resources allow other local users to observe screen contents (information disclosure), manipulate screen content (data modification), or cause the application to crash (denial of service).

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.
dbcve checksWork through these to decide whether this CVE applies to you.
-
Confirm TigerVNC installationRun 'vncserver --version' or 'vncviewer --version' to check if TigerVNC is installed on the systemAffected if No TigerVNC binary is found or the command fails
-
Identify installed TigerVNC versionExecute the version command from the previous step and compare the output to 1.16.2. Look for version strings like 'TigerVNC 1.x.y' where x.y is less than 16.2Affected if The installed version is before 1.16.2 (for example, 1.15.0, 1.14.1, etc.)
-
Verify x0vncserver component presenceCheck if the x0vncserver binary exists on the system using 'which x0vncserver' or by listing /usr/bin/x0vncserver or similar pathsAffected if The x0vncserver binary is present and the TigerVNC version is below 1.16.2
-
Determine if x0vncserver is actively runningCheck running processes with 'ps aux | grep x0vncserver' or review any systemd service files or startup scripts that reference x0vncserverAffected if x0vncserver is currently running or configured to run, combined with a vulnerable version
-
Inspect shared memory/framebuffer resource permissionsUse 'ipcs -m' to list shared memory segments while x0vncserver is running, and check file permissions on /tmp/.X11-unix or similar X11 socket directories if applicableAffected if Resources used by x0vncserver show overly permissive access (world-readable or world-writable) that would allow other local users to access them
The environment is affected if TigerVNC version 1.16.2 or later is NOT installed AND the x0vncserver component is in use or planned for use.

Upgrade to TigerVNC version 1.16.2 or later which contains the corrected permission handling in x0vncserver.
1.16.2
- Check current installed version of TigerVNC (e.g., `vncserver -version` or check package manager)
- Upgrade TigerVNC to version 1.16.2 or later using your distribution's package manager (e.g., `apt update && apt install tigervnc` on Debian/Ubuntu, `yum update tigervnc` on RHEL/CentOS, or compile from source)
- Verify the upgrade was successful by checking the version: `vncserver -version` or `x0vncserver -version`
- Restart any running VNC server instances to ensure the patched version is in use
